gid in American English
a disease, esp. of sheep, caused by the larvae of a tapeworm (Multiceps multiceps) in the brain or spinal cord noun: a disease of cattle and esp. of sheep in which the brain or spinal cord is infested with larvae of the dog tapeworm, Multiceps multiceps, producing staggers |
